AN ORDINANCE
AUTHORIZING THE EXECUTION OF AN AMENDMENT TO THE TRAVEL
CONCESSION AGREEMENT WITH SANBORN'S TRAVEL SERVICE, INC. TO
INCLUDE THE SALE OF TRAVEL INSURANCE THROUGH ALL INSURANCE
COMPANIES IT DEALS WITH; AND DECLARING AN EMERGENCY.
BE IT ORDAINED BY TH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F CORPUS CHRISTI,
TEXAS:
SECTION 1. That the City Manager is hereby authorized to execute an
amendment to the travel concession agreement with Sanborn's Travel Service, Inc.
to include the sale of travel insurance through all insurance companies it deals
with for a rental of 15 percent of gross sales at the airport, all as more fully
set forth in the amendment, a substantial copy of which is attached hereto and
made a part hereof, marked Exhibit "A".
SECTION 2. That upon written request of the Mayor or five Council
members, copy attached, to find and declare an emergency due to the need of
executing the abovementioned amendment at the earliest practicable date, such
finding of an emergency is made and declared requiring suspension of the Charter
rule as to consideration and voting upon ordinances or resolutions at three
regular meetings so that this ordinance is passed and shall take effect upon
first reading as an emergency measure this the 12th day of November, 1985.

AMENDMENT NO. 1 TO THE
AGREEMENT FOR TRAVEL SERVICES AT THE
CORPUS CHRISTI INTERNATIONAL AIRPORT
The City of Corpus Christi, hereinafter called "City", and Village
Travel, Inc., hereinafter called Concessionaire, agree to the following
amendment to the Agreement for Travel Services at the Corpus Christi
International Airport authorized by City Council on June 1, 1983, by passage
of Ordinance No. 17621.
Section 3, FEES TO THE CITY, shall be amended to include the following:
In addition to the payment of minimum annual concession fees stated in
the original Agreement, Concessionaire agrees to pay 15% of the gross revenues
from the sale of travel insurance according to the terms of the original
Agreement.
Section 4, RESPONSIBILITIES OF CONCESSIONAIRE, shall be amended by adding
Subsection (6), Sale of travel insurance.
All other terms and conditions of the Agreement approved on June 1, 1983,
by the City and Concessionaire not specifically addressed herein shall remain
in full force and effect.
